Sofa collection from the room it is in

An old sofa is easy to decide against and awkward to move. Tell us the number of seats, whether it is a corner sofa, and if it contains a recliner or bed mechanism. Those details help us assess the size and weight. A photograph showing the entire sofa is more useful than a close-up of the fabric.

Sofa removal from flats and narrow rooms

Check how the sofa originally came into the property. It may split into sections or have removable feet, but the team needs to know that before arrival. Photograph tight doors and staircase turns, and mention any lift. Do not force a sofa through an opening or leave it blocking a shared landing while waiting for collection.

Plan around your replacement sofa

Arrange the timing before accepting a fixed delivery slot for new furniture where possible. Remove throws, cushions you are keeping and anything stored in a sofa bed. If you are also replacing a matching chair or footstool, include it in the original enquiry. Changes to the load should be agreed with the collection team.
